How to Get Good Breath?

How to Get Good Breath?

Here are 9 things that you can do to have better oral health and good breath. Check out the best possible ways to treat the problems related with bad breath.

  1. Regular Brushing

    The most important thing you can do about bad breath is brush your teeth twice a day. Just like mouth rinsing, brush your teeth properly so that no plaque builds on your teeth which is a breeding ground for bad breath. For toothpaste, go for products which are rich in natural ingredients that provide relief from bad breath.

  2. Using Mouthwashes

    Regular use of mouthwash is one of the best ways to get a good breadth. There is a sequence which has to be followed in order to ensure getting a good breath. Mouthwash is best used after you are done with brushing your teeth. There are various mouthwashes available and you can choose the one that suits you the best or as advised by your dentist. While going for mouthwash that is highly alkaline, remember that it has to be done before flossing but after brushing your teeth. Correct way of using this mouthwash makes sure that your teeth get maximum absorption of fluoride which protects your teeth from problems.

  3. Saline Gargles

    You can also choose to use saline water which acts as a natural alternative to mouthwash. Saline gargles with warm water is a traditional way to fight bad breath and keep dental as well as throat infections at bay.

  4. Tongue Scraping

    Scraping of tongue is effective in removing bad breath and enhances your oral health. It is recommended that you clean your tongue after finishing your meals and brush well. Use the scraper in the morning and after you have finished your meals which significantly reduces the bacteria in your mouth. This is undeniably one of the best ways to get a good breath.

  5. Drinking Water

    When you keep your mouth hydrated, it is easier to do away with the bad breath problem. Drink plenty of water to keep your body well hydrated, which can also help prevent digestive problems and ultimately give you a good breath.

  6. Rinsing Mouth

    After every meal or snacks, make sure to clean your mouth free from any food particles which cause bad breath and tooth decay. Plain water rinse works well and you can also choose to rinse your mouth with warm water, which is one of the simplest ways to get a good breath.

  7. Chewing Power Foods

    Certain foods can protect the gum and chances of decay begin to die down. For instance, an avocado and parsley leaves can be chewed after meals. Another good thing you can do about bad breath is to eat unripe guava, aniseed and cardamom seeds, as they too aid good oral hygiene.

  8. Eating Digestive Foods

    If you are taking fruits which are rich in digestive enzymes then keeping away bad breath is possible. Fruits such as kiwi, pineapple and papaya promote healthy digestion and help to ward off bad breath.

  9. Oil Pulling

    This strategy as a cure for bad breath has become quite popular owing to the promising results. You pick the organic or extra virgin oil which shells out bad breath from your mouth thus ensuring oral health. If you have chosen coconut oil then simply swish it for few minutes and spit away the oil.
